Local Laws Overview:

Local laws in Puerto Peñasco related to oil, gas, and energy are governed by federal regulations set forth by the Mexican government. Key aspects include licensing and permitting for energy projects, environmental impact assessments, taxation, and land use rights. It is important to understand these laws to avoid legal complications and ensure compliance with regulatory requirements.

Frequently Asked Questions:

1. What are the key regulations governing oil, gas, and energy in Puerto Peñasco?

The key regulations governing oil, gas, and energy in Puerto Peñasco are established by the Mexican government through the Ministry of Energy (SENER) and the National Hydrocarbons Commission (CNH). These regulations cover licensing, permits, environmental impact assessments, and taxation.
